What are the most common auto repair issues you see on vehicles in Taylorville, and are they related to local driving conditions?

We frequently address issues related to pothole damage (suspension, alignments, and tires) due to seasonal freeze-thaw cycles on local roads, as well as battery failures and corrosion from our humid summers and cold winters. Rust prevention and undercarriage inspections are also common due to road salt used in winter.

What is a typical price range for common repairs like brakes or an oil change in Taylorville?

Pricing is competitive but can vary; a standard oil change typically ranges from $40-$70, while a brake pad replacement for one axle usually falls between $250-$400. Always request a detailed written estimate upfront, as labor rates differ slightly between local shops.

When should I seek service for a check engine light, and are there local resources for diagnostics?

Seek service promptly, as a check engine light can indicate issues from a loose gas cap to serious engine problems. Most reputable Taylorville repair shops have the modern diagnostic tools to read codes specific to your vehicle and can advise if it's safe to drive to their location.

Are there any local considerations for vehicle maintenance specific to the Taylorville area?

Yes, preparing your vehicle for Central Illinois seasons is key. This includes checking coolant/antifreeze levels before winter, ensuring air conditioning is serviced for humid summers, and being proactive with tire rotations and alignments due to the wear from rural and occasionally rough town roads.
